Transaction 28e7d530c2ae9431faf4f279af30b36af7951a24cc5398e25b4959a3eb1f3652
1 Input
1 Output
-
28e7d530c2ae9431faf4f279af30b36af7951a24cc5398e25b4959a3eb1f3652:0
- value
- 8998376
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ff95be807d5e221674f2e7e7ffdc428cf2adc74 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E8GMCZxv2Uecxcg7TNS964Tjxgt2DJVQU